a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/Environment/Scenes/SceneObjectPart.cs
diff options
context:
space:
mode:
authorTeravus Ovares2008-02-10 21:27:32 +0000
committerTeravus Ovares2008-02-10 21:27:32 +0000
commit38f0615ffef1b60d98029ca433d158d97c0d0183 (patch)
tree56b476fcb1696dcb8de3e310e8e93b79f36a125a /OpenSim/Region/Environment/Scenes/SceneObjectPart.cs
parentRemoved some ScriptEngine config debugging. (diff)
downloadopensim-SC_OLD-38f0615ffef1b60d98029ca433d158d97c0d0183.zip
opensim-SC_OLD-38f0615ffef1b60d98029ca433d158d97c0d0183.tar.gz
opensim-SC_OLD-38f0615ffef1b60d98029ca433d158d97c0d0183.tar.bz2
opensim-SC_OLD-38f0615ffef1b60d98029ca433d158d97c0d0183.tar.xz
* This updates adds locking capability. Thanks, lbsa71 for pointing out my bitmasking error of the objectflags! It's still a little bit wonky when you check the checkbox, however it 'takes' and doesn't break anything.
Diffstat (limited to '')
-rw-r--r--OpenSim/Region/Environment/Scenes/SceneObjectPart.cs9
1 files changed, 5 insertions, 4 deletions
diff --git a/OpenSim/Region/Environment/Scenes/SceneObjectPart.cs b/OpenSim/Region/Environment/Scenes/SceneObjectPart.cs
index 8c25dfa..06c0472 100644
--- a/OpenSim/Region/Environment/Scenes/SceneObjectPart.cs
+++ b/OpenSim/Region/Environment/Scenes/SceneObjectPart.cs
@@ -1620,13 +1620,14 @@ namespace OpenSim.Region.Environment.Scenes
1620 { 1620 {
1621 if (addRemTF == (byte)0) 1621 if (addRemTF == (byte)0)
1622 { 1622 {
1623 m_parentGroup.SetLocked(true); 1623 //m_parentGroup.SetLocked(true);
1624 //OwnerMask &= ~mask; 1624 //PermissionMask.
1625 OwnerMask &= ~mask;
1625 } 1626 }
1626 else 1627 else
1627 { 1628 {
1628 m_parentGroup.SetLocked(false); 1629 //m_parentGroup.SetLocked(false);
1629 //OwnerMask |= mask; 1630 OwnerMask |= mask;
1630 } 1631 }
1631 SendFullUpdateToAllClients(); 1632 SendFullUpdateToAllClients();
1632 1633